Christmas Carol Quiz Answers

  1. Good King Wenceslas looked out 'on the Feast of Stephen'. When is the 'Feast of Stephen'? Answer - December 26

  2. What did the shepherds watch by night? Answer - Their Flocks

  3. To whom did the Angels say 'The First Noel'?  Answer - To certain poor shepherds

  4. What Decked the halls in the famous carol? Answer - Boughs of holly

  5. What stood in 'Once in royal Davids city'? Answer - A lowly cattle shed

  6. What's the name of the carol about Christmas evergreen plants?  Answer - The Holly and the Ivy

  7. Who travelled across 'Field and fountain, moor and mountain'? Answer - We three kings of Orient are...

  8. What other name is given to the carol "O Tannenbaum"? Answer - O Christmas Tree

  9. What is the sub-title, or other name, of the carol Adeste Fideles? Answer - O Come all ye faithful

  10. The following letters represent each of the words in the title of which carol? ITBMW Answer - In The Bleak MidWinter

  11. The following letters represent each of the words in the title of which carol? OLTOB Answer - OLTOB - Oh little town of Bethlehem

  12. According to the carol, how many ships came sailing in on Christmas Day? Answer - Three

  13. 'The cattle are lowing' are lyrics taken from which carol?  Answer - Away in a manger

  14. 'Tis the season to be jolly' are lyrics taken from which carol? Answer - Deck the Halls

  15. Who sang "Glory to the newborn King!" in the famous carol?  Answer - The Herald Angels

  16. 'Holy Infant so tender and mild' are lyrics taken from which carol? Answer - Silent Night

  17. 'And the running of the deer' are lyrics taken from which carol? Answer - Holly and the Ivy

  18. The following letters represent each of the words in the title of which carol? DDMOH Answer - Ding Dong Merrily On High

  19. The following letters represent each of the words in the title of which carol? OIRDC Answer - Once in Royal David's City

  20. 'O tidings of comfort and joy' are lyrics taken from which carol?  Answer - God Rest Ye Merry Gentlemen
